TikTok, the Chinese-owned short-form video-hosting service that caused a stir in North America, officially returns

[/media-credit]According to multiple reports (and the notification I received late last night on my device), TikTok and its sister app CapCut have returned to the United States digital stores (Google Play and the Apple Store). The change comes as a result of assurances from the Trump administration that a ban wouldn’t immediately be enforced. However, the apparent security risks remain. Before anyone jumps to conclusions, let’s give it time to see how it all plays out. Under President Trump’s presidency, he may be able to get an American buyer. Some people are interested in acquiring the Chinese internet company ByteDance app, including YouTube star MrBeast. Notably, Marck Cuban is ready to fund a TikTok alternative built on Bluesky’s AT Protocol.

YouTube star MrBeast’s bold bid to acquire TikTok sparks industry buzz

[/media-credit]Popular YouTuber and entrepreneur MrBeast (Jimmy Donaldson) has reportedly expressed interest in acquiring TikTok, the global short-form video platform. Known for his groundbreaking content and innovative business ventures, MrBeast’s potential acquisition would mark a seismic shift in social media ownership. With TikTok facing scrutiny and regulatory hurdles, the move could stabilise the platform while enhancing its creator-centric ethos. MrBeast’s established expertise in captivating Gen Z audiences aligns perfectly with TikTok’s user base. Whilst financial and operational challenges loom, this bold endeavour could redefine the future of digital entertainment. Industry insiders are watching closely as talks unfold.

TikTok to rollout 32-person group chat

[/media-credit]This week, TikTok announced the delivery of its new thirty-two-people group chat. According to MSN, all users can watch, comment, and react to videos in real-time. The company explained, “To enhance user experience and make connecting with friends even more seamless and enjoyable, we’re excited to introduce new updates that elevate DMs, including the highly requested group chat feature.” To see how it works, visit this link.
